Azerbaijani FM discusses normalization process with Armenia with NATO Deputy Secretary General

On January 22, 2026, the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Azerbaijan, Jeyhun Bayramov, received the Deputy Secretary General of NATO, Radmila Šekerinská,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s reports.
During the meeting, the current cooperation agenda and prospects between Azerbaijan and NATO within the framework of partnership, the work carried out within partnership mechanisms, as well as regional and international security issues were discussed.
During the meeting, information was also provided on the Azerbaijan–Armenia normalization process, diplomatic efforts and confidence-building measures aimed at ensuring sustainable and lasting peace in the region, the agreements reached within the framework of the August 8 Washington summit and peace prospects, as well as regional transport and connectivity projects.
